Cricketer Mathew Pillans Biography - Cricket Profile

- Full Name: Mathew Pillans
- Birth Date: 04 Jul, 1991
- Age: 29 years 91 days
- Batting Style: Right-hand bat
- Bowling Style: Right-arm fast
- Teams: Dolphins
